Acacia decurrens (Fabaceae) 1:130

  

Acacia decurrens  is an introduced species of Acacia (native to New South Wales). It resemble black wattle (A. mearnsii), but the leaves are decurrent, forming wings along the stems. The leaflets are also more widely spaced than those of A. mearnsii or A. dealbata.
